來自這個酒莊
  • 創業年份: 2013
Hellgarten, a small German village in the Rheingau area, is where the wines of the Bibo Runge winery are born. The company was founded in 2013 by Walter Bibo and Markus Bonsels, both of whom had a great passion for wine, with important experiences gained in other wineries in the area.

The Rheingau is characterized by the Rhine river which, in addition to designing the beautiful scenery, contributes to the uniqueness of the particular microclimate, thus influencing the ripening of the grapes. The philosophy of Bibo Runge is centered on a fundamental principle: patience. To achieve the highest possible quality, long macerations are carried out on the skins, followed by prolonged fermentation and aging in wood.

Riesling, the only variety cultivated by the company, is thus enhanced in different versions starting from the "trocken", the one with the least residual sugar, to the persuasive Rheingau Riesling Spätlese QbA "Winkeler Hasensprung", from grapes harvested late. Bibo Runge also produces a classic method sparkling wine from Riesling grapes, with a maturation on yeasts of 18 months.

The wines mature within ancient cellars located in the heart of Hellgarten, a town that boasts over 900 of wine history. Bibo Runge is synonymous with wines with a strong character, capable of reflecting in the glass all the complexity of the grapes and the greatness of a territory unique in the world.
